Marvin VI

Drive Train

  • 6WD with an 1/8 inch center drop
  • Colson Wheels
  • AndyMark Super Shifters 4:1 and 20:1 ratios
  • Belt Driven
  • Hex Output Shafts!
  • Talons

Shooter

  • Complete turret (Pan and Tilt)
  • Automated targeting using a Microsoft Kinect and an Onboard Processor running RoboRealm (using IR)
  • Field Realtive Setpoints with memorization functions to allow new shooting positions to be used on the fly
  • Inspired by Robot in Three Days

Other Things

  • Off Center Turret
  • 1st level climber
  • 7 second climb
  • Single disk Pickup mechanism
  • 3 disk autonomous (working on 4!)
  • Active PID control on Turret
  • Multiple Field relative setpoints allow the drivers to shoot to a goal regardless of how the drive base is positioned
  • Absolute turret position using potentiometers
  • LEDs!
  • LabVIEW Programming

Can you describe how your floor intake gets disks to your shooter? I can’t quite tell from the render?

At 1:45 in the video (pause it, nice picture), you can see the floor grabber down, then the turret comes down and meshes with the grabber. As the grabber is running backwards to pull in disks, so are the shooter wheels, so instead of rotating the shooter wheels forwards to shoot a disk, they rotate backwards to suck a disk in backwards through the shooter and into the breach.
